Crockpot Pork Roast with Onion Garlic Sauce

Equipment

  • Crockpot

Ingredients

  • 2-3 lb Pork Roast
  • 1 Med Onion, diced
  • 1 T Minced Garlic
  • 1 t Sat;
  • 1/2 t Ground Black Pepper
  • 1 1/2 t Smoked Paprika
  • 1 t Garlic Powder
  • 1 t Onion Powder
  • 1 T Olive oil
  • 3/4 C Broth, dry white wine, or Water
  • 1/4-1/2 C Heavy Cream
  • 1/2-1 t Xanthan Gum

Instructions

  • Mix the seasonings together and coat the pork roast.
  • Place a medium to large skillet over medium heat. Add your oil. Carefully place your roast on the skillet.
  • Brown the roast on all sides. Carefully remove the roast and place into your crockpot.
  • Add your diced onion into the hot skillet and cook for about 3-4 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for another 2 minutes.
  • Add the broth and cook for about a minute.
  • Pour the onion-broth mixture over the roast. Cook for 6-8 hours on low or 4 on high.
  • When the time us up, remove the roast from the crockpot.
  • Add the desired amount of heavy cream to the crockpot.
  • Whisk in the xanthan gum. Don't add too much, it will take a couple minutes to thicken.
  • After the roast has rested for a few minutes, slice.
  • Serve with the sauce on top.
